Tyler John Matakevich is an American football linebacker.
Education
Matakevich attended Saint Joseph High School in Trumbull, Connecticut. He finished his high school career with 2,357 yards rushing, 1,355 yards receiving, 3,898 all-purpose yards on offense, & 371 tackles, 4.5 sacks, 3 forced fumbles, 6 fumble recoveries, & 8 interceptions on defense.

After one year at Milford Academy, Matakevich committed to Temple University to play college football. As a freshman at Temple in 2012, Matakevich played and started in all 13 games.
He became the first freshman in school history to record 100 tackles, finishing with 101. As a sophomore he had 137 tackles, one sack and one interception.
As a junior he had 117 tackles, 1.5 sacks and one interception.
During his senior year he became the seventh player in FBS history to record 100 tackles all four years. All three were firsts for Temple football. He also became Temple"s third consensus All-American.
During the 2015 Boca Raton Bowl, he broke the school"s record for career tackles, finishing with 493.
